Lot Grading in Houston, TX

Lot grading services involve shaping and leveling the land around a property to ensure proper drainage and stability. This process is essential for a variety of projects, including preparing a site for new construction, improving drainage around existing structures, or preventing water pooling and erosion. Property owners typically request lot grading to create a smooth, even surface that directs water away from foundations, walkways, and landscaping, helping to protect the property from water damage and ensuring safe, functional outdoor spaces.

Before requesting lot grading services, property owners should consider the current state of their land, including existing slopes, drainage patterns, and any areas prone to pooling or erosion. It’s important to understand the scope of the work needed, such as whether regrading is necessary to correct drainage issues or if minor adjustments will suffice. Clarifying the goals for water management and site stability can help ensure the project meets expectations and provides long-term benefits for the property.

Lot Grading Questions

What is lot grading? Lot grading involves shaping the land surface to ensure proper drainage away from structures and prevent water pooling around the property.

Why is lot grading important for homeowners? Proper lot grading helps protect foundations, reduces erosion, and minimizes water damage to landscaping and structures.

What types of projects typically require lot grading services? Projects include new construction site preparation, landscape redesigns, drainage correction, and foundation protection.

How does lot grading improve property safety? Effective grading directs water away from buildings, reducing the risk of water intrusion, soil erosion, and related structural issues.
